Favorite game

My favourite game to play is "BANG!" This is a 4 or more player game. To play this game the people that are playing have to get into the circle but one person has to stand in the middle.

The person in the middle has a job but that person has to learn all the peoples names. Once the person in the middle knows everyone's name he then has to say one persons name.

The person he choose has to bob down and the people next to him have say bang to each other. If you don't say it fast enough your out but if someone else says bang they are out.

When there are only 2 people left. The person in the middle has to give them a key word like blue or ball. Then the person in the middle will tell them story and while the person is telling the story the last 2 people have to walk forward. Once they hear the key word they have to turn around and say bang. If you say it before the other person you win but if you are to slow you lose.`

Michel Mayor

The person I chose was Michel Mayor. He was born 12 January 1942 in Lausanne which is in Switzerland. He is a Swiss astrophysicist. He was also a professor emeritus at the University of Geneva in the Astronomy department. Michel got the Nobel Prize in Physics 2019 for the discovery of an exoplanet orbiting a solar-type star. He retired in 2007 but still does research.
